The Fledgling Archfey

After being bound to the lingering power of an exiled archfey of Thelanis, you take on the following traits:  
  • Your current class levels may be exchanged for Warlock levels, with the pact of the archfey subclass. Your ability scores, skill proficiencies and tool proficiencies remain as they were before, however you may choose to exchange any feats you have taken for a different feat of your choice.
  • For the purposes of all item and feat prerequisites, you still count as your previous class.
  • Your type changes to both humanoid and fey, and you can be affected by abilities that apply to either creature type. For example, you can be both paralyzed by hold person, and trapped within a magic circle.
  • The touch of iron on your skin becomes uncomfortable to you. You are vulnerable to damage caused by cold iron, forged without fire and infused with magic to slay the fey.
  • You are treated as under the effects of the geas spell, with the command "Do not tell a lie or untruth, and keep all of your promises". This geas lasts until you forfeit your power, and has no limit to the number of times per day you may suffer damage from it. You may still deceive, manipulate and talk around questions, or follow through on the letter but not the spirit of a promise, but are compelled to avoid direct lies.
  • You learn the geas spell, which can be cast without requiring a spell slot, but only with a command that enforces a promise that they have made to you.
  • This power and obligation is limited in its scope, coming from the discarded, tattered power of a lord without a land. It may increase with time, as you work to establish a true court with power and vassals, claim territory within the feywild itself, and fully embody a grand role in the world's story.
